Oxidation of Am(III) in carbonate - bicarbonate solution by sodium perxenate

Journal Article · · Radiochemistry
OSTI ID:28613
The oxidation of Am(III) by Na{sub 4}XeO{sub 6} in KHCO{sub 3}, KHCO{sub 3} + K{sub 2}CO{sub 3}, and K{sub 2}CO{sub 3} solutions is studied by spectrophotometry. In 1.5M solutions (HCO{sub 3}{sup {minus}} + CO{sub 3}{sup 2{minus}}) with perxenate concentrations comparable to those of Am, Am(III) is quickly converted to a mixture of Am(IV) + Am(V) + Am(VI). In concentrated K{sub 2}CO{sub 3} solutions (5.9 M), Am(III) is in general not oxidized by perxenate. A mechanism is proposed for the oxidation of Am(III) by perxenate that includes the reaction of Am(III) with Xe(VIII) and possibly with Xe(VI). The reaction of Na{sub 4}XeO{sub 6} and Am(IV) was also investigated. In this instance Am(IV) was quickly converted to Am(V) and Am(VI).
